UCLA QB Josh Rosen undergoes surgery on right shoulder

Associated Press

LOS ANGELES – UCLA quarterback Josh Rosen underwent surgery Monday morning on his right shoulder for a soft tissue injury.

UCLA said in a statement that the sophomore, who injured his shoulder during a 23-20 loss at Arizona State on Oct. 8, is expected to make a full recovery.

Before the injury, Rosen had thrown for 1,915 yards and 10 touchdowns with five interceptions.

Senior Mike Fafaul, a former walk-on, has led UCLA (3-6) in Rosen’s absence.
